Description

Kent Downs AONB and North Downs Way (NDW) National Trail through the Interreg Europe Programme are seeking an Arts & Creative partner to manage a project that will create four new art installations on (or near) The Via Francigena in Kent. The work will contribute towards the creation and promotion of off-season experiential tourism products and sustainable, rural tourism. The work is closely aligned to a wider sustainable tourism project delivered by the Interreg Channel (FCE) EXPERIENCE project and will be managed by the Kent Downs EXPERIENCE team.
